INTERNAL MEMO — Records Team

Re: Seed samples, Wrenfold trial plot

The sealed seed samples for the Wrenfold trial plot ship Thursday via bonded courier. Please log each packet against the varietal register before release, noting batch, weight, and seal condition. Retain one duplicate packet in cold storage. The courier hand-over must follow the instruction stated below.

handover note for yagef-bagep: the drudor pelius courier leaves the kasdor zorvan norir ledger at gate 8016 under passcode 755406

Onboarding: tailfox CLI

tailfox is our internal tool for tailing service logs across the Marrowgate clusters. It wraps the log gateway, handles auth tokens automatically, and supports regex filters via the -m flag. Config lives in your home directory after first run. Known quirk: multi-region tails drop lines under heavy load. Report issues to the tooling rotation.

alerts address for bawif-hahig: norwyn_gorys_lamath@olvarqlabs.test

## Alert: KioskGuard Watchdog Trip

Fires when the Breezeway kiosk watchdog restarts the shell more than three times in ten minutes. Usual cause: a plugin blocking the render loop past the 4s budget. Check your plugin's heartbeat hook first; watchdog logs name the offending bundle. Repeated trips auto-disable the plugin until re-certified. To request re-certification or dispute a disablement, contact the kiosk platform team.

alerts address for kajog-tadup: druox@plorvanet.internal

Document Transport — Sealed Exam Papers. The Thornfield Institute exam cartons arrive sealed with numbered tamper strips. Shift lead: store them in the locked cage, never on open shelving, and record each strip number on arrival. Only the designated courier may collect them. At collection, follow the confidential hand-over instruction recorded below this entry.

drop instructions, yafog-yawip: the quenmir olidor courier leaves the julox tamion keliel ledger at gate 5283 under passcode 336825